What Is Metaphysics?

Metaphysics is the branch of philosophy that deals with the first principles of life—the nature of reality, being, knowing, cause, substance, identity, time, and space. Originally, the term metaphysics was used to describe Aristotle’s teachings that went beyond physics, addressing First Cause, universals and particulars, and the underlying intelligence behind creation.

Over time, metaphysics expanded beyond philosophy alone. It became an inquiry into what lies behind appearances, asking not only what is, but why it is.

At its heart, metaphysics seeks to understand the nature of reality, both visible and invisible, and how the Principles of the Universe apply directly to our lives.

Metaphysics and First Cause

Metaphysics has long explored whether reality exists beyond experience, as Plato taught, or whether experience itself constitutes reality, as argued by thinkers such as Kant and Hume. It also asks whether existence is made of one substance or many, and whether life unfolds by chance or by law.

The Science of Mind Perspective

Ernest Holmes, founder of Science of Mind, expressed it this way:

“There is a power in the universe which acts as though it were intelligent—and we may assume that it is.
There is an activity in the universe which acts as law.
And there is a formless substance forever taking form and forever changing its form.”

From this, we recognize a threefold nature of Being:

  • Spirit as the conscious, knowing Power

  • Soul (Law) as the medium of action

  • Body (Form) as the result

Spirit is the only conscious actor. Law is impersonal and exact, responding to the Word spoken into it. Form is the visible result. One Power alone acts, expressing through law into form.
